#5BCEDF Hex Color Code

#5BCEDF

The Hexadecimal Color #5BCEDF is a contrast shade of Medium Turquoise. #5BCEDF RGB value is rgb(91, 206, 223). RGB Color Model of #5BCEDF consists of 35% red, 80% green and 87% blue. HSL color Mode of #5BCEDF has 188°(degrees) Hue, 67% Saturation and 62% Lightness. #5BCEDF color has an wavelength of 501.62963n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#5BCEDF is #66FFF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#5BCEDF is #5CD. The Closest Color to #5BCEDF is #48D1CC. Official Name of #5BCEDF Hex Code is Viking.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#5BCEDF is 59 Cyan 8 Magenta 0 Yellow 13 Black and #5BCEDF CMY is 59, 8,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#5BCEDF is hsl(188,67,62,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(188, 59, 87).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#5BCEDF is 39.7, 51.69, 77.68.
Hex8 Value of #5BCEDF is #5BCEDFFF. Decimal Value of #5BCEDF is 6016735 and Octal Value of #5BCEDF is 26747337. Binary Value of #5BCEDF is 1011011, 11001110, 11011111 and Android of #5BCEDF is 4284206815 / 0xff5bcedf.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#5BCEDF is 0.235, 0.306, 0.306 and YIQ Color Space of #5BCEDF is 173.553, -73.9906, -19.0321.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#5BCEDF is 38.68, 60.28, 77.21.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#5BCEDF is 77.1, -27.52, -18.2.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#5BCEDF is 77.1, -46.43, -24.54.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#5BCEDF is 77.1, 32.99, 213.48. Hunter Lab variable of #5BCEDF is 71.9, -27.25, -13.73.

Analogous and Monochromatic Colors of #5BCEDF

Analogous colors are groups of hues that are located next to each other on the color wheel. These colors share a similar undertone and create a sense of harmony when used together. Analogous color schemes are mainly used in design or art to create a sense of cohesion and flow in a color scheme composition.

Monochromatic colors refer to a color scheme that uses variations of a single color. These variations are achieved by adjusting the shade, tint, or tone of the base color. Monochromatic approach is commonly used in interior design or fashion to create a sense of understated elegance and give a sense of simplicity and consistency.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#5BCEDF

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
